**Mgmt Meeting Minutes — Retiring the Brightline Range**

Quick recap for sales leads at Fenholt Supplies: we agreed to retire the Brightline fixture range by year-end. Remaining stock moves to clearance pricing next month, and accounts on standing orders get migrated to the Lumetta range. Trade-in incentives were approved in principle. The confidential note on next steps sits just below.

board note of bajof-bajeg: The pricing group signed off on a budget of $13.4 million for Project Sildor. The renewal with Lamixek Holdings closes at $48.9 million a year, 49 percent above the last contract.

TICKET: Inventory reconciliation job failing on worker pool B

The Stockmend nightly reconcile against the Binledger warehouse API has errored for three runs. Root cause: the staging `.env` was copied to production during last week's rebuild, so the job authenticates with a revoked credential and every batch 401s. Counts are drifting; Palliser Foods flagged discrepancies this morning. Fix tonight before the 02:00 run. Edit `/etc/stockmend/.env` on pool B and set the production API credential on the next line.

sealed setting: ARCHIVE_KEY3=8d0

### Reconnect Loop Analysis — Driftline Gateway

When the Driftline gateway drops a websocket during token refresh, clients at Harwick Labs re-authenticate with a stale nonce, producing an unbounded reconnect storm. We propose jittered exponential backoff with a hard session cap, validated server-side. The security-relevant constants governing backoff and nonce lifetime are listed below.

tuning constants:
QUOTAS = {
    "druwyn": 5,
    "holix": 5,
    "zorath": 5,
    "holwyn": 10,
}

Welcome, plugin authors. All user-supplied formulas run inside the Calcvine sandbox: a restricted interpreter with no filesystem, network, or reflection access, and a 50ms per-cell budget. Your plugin declares which built-in functions it needs, and anything undeclared is rejected at load time rather than at runtime, so test thoroughly. To submit a plugin for verification, the sandbox harness must authenticate against our review gateway. Put the gateway credential on the line immediately after this one in your local env file.

sealed setting: VAULT_KEY20=69e2a0b23f1a79fbf692